Russian President Putin to pay state visit to Tajikistan on October 9

President of the Russian Federation Vladimir Putin is to pay a state visit to Tajikistan on October 8–9, Khovar reports citing Tajik MFA Information department.
In accordance with the program of the stay in the city of Dushanbe, a wreath-laying ceremony at the Ismoil Somoni Monument, as well as one-on-one and expanded talks between heads of state, and the signing of interstate and intergovernmental documents are planned.
Following the meeting, a number of documents are set to be adopted.
